What is Wheel Refurbishment?
Wheel refurbishment is a specialised automotive service focused on repairing and restoring damaged alloy wheels. This can involve a range of techniques to address different types of damage, from minor cosmetic blemishes to more significant structural issues. The primary goal is to return the wheel to a condition that is as close as possible to its original state, both in terms of appearance and structural integrity. This is a far more sustainable and economical approach than purchasing new wheels, which can be prohibitively expensive.
Common Types of Wheel Damage
Alloy wheels, while offering many benefits over traditional steel wheels, are susceptible to various forms of damage:
- Kerb Damage: Perhaps the most common issue, caused by accidentally scraping the wheel against a kerb or pavement. This typically results in scuffs, scratches, and gouges on the rim's surface.
- Corrosion: Road salt, moisture, and brake dust can penetrate the protective lacquer on alloy wheels, leading to unsightly white spots, pitting, and bubbling. This can compromise the wheel's finish and, in severe cases, the metal itself.
- Scratches and Scuffs: Beyond kerb damage, minor scratches can occur from debris on the road or careless handling during tyre changes.
- Bent or Cracked Rims: More severe impacts, such as hitting a deep pothole, can cause the wheel to bend or even crack. While some bends can be repaired, significant cracks may necessitate replacement.
- Pothole Damage: Similar to bent rims, hitting a pothole can lead to dents, bends, and structural compromise.
- Paint Flaking: The protective coating on wheels can degrade over time, leading to peeling or flaking paint, which is both unsightly and offers less protection.
The Wheel Refurbishment Process
The exact process can vary depending on the type and severity of the damage, but a typical comprehensive refurbishment involves several key stages:
Inspection and Assessment:
The process begins with a thorough inspection of the wheel to identify all types of damage, including hidden issues like internal corrosion or minor bends. The technician will determine the best course of action for repair and restoration.
Tyre Removal:
The tyre is carefully removed from the wheel using specialised tyre-fitting equipment to prevent any damage to the tyre bead or the wheel itself.
Cleaning:
The wheel is thoroughly cleaned to remove all dirt, brake dust, grease, and old paint or lacquer. This often involves chemical cleaning and high-pressure washing.
Damage Repair:
- Kerb/Scuff Repair: Minor scuffs and scratches are typically removed using grinding and sanding techniques. For more significant damage, techniques like welding might be employed to fill gouges before sanding.
- Straightening: If the wheel is bent, it can be straightened using a specialised wheel straightening machine. This process carefully applies controlled pressure to return the rim to its original shape.
- Crack Repair: Minor cracks can sometimes be repaired through welding, though this is dependent on the size and location of the crack. For larger or more critical cracks, replacement is often the only safe option.
Surface Preparation:
Once repairs are complete, the wheel is prepared for coating. This involves further sanding and priming to create a smooth, uniform surface. The old paint and lacquer are completely stripped, often through a chemical stripping or media blasting process.
Powder Coating or Painting:
This is where the wheel gets its new finish. The most common and durable methods are:
- Powder Coating: A dry powder is electrostatically applied to the wheel and then cured under heat. This creates a very durable and attractive finish. It's available in a vast range of colours and effects.
- Liquid Painting: Similar to how a car is painted, this involves applying multiple layers of primer, base coat (colour), and clear coat. This offers a high-quality finish and a wide spectrum of colours, but may not be as durable as powder coating against chipping.
Lacquer Application:
A final clear coat of lacquer is applied to protect the paintwork and provide a glossy or satin finish. This layer is crucial for preventing future corrosion and damage.
Baking/Curing:
Whether powder coated or liquid painted, the wheel is usually baked in an oven to cure the finish, ensuring maximum hardness and durability.
Quality Control and Tyre Refitting:
The refurbished wheel is inspected for any imperfections. Once approved, the tyre is carefully refitted, and the wheel is balanced to ensure smooth rotation.
Types of Refurbishment Finishes
The aesthetic possibilities are vast. Common finishes include:
- Standard Silver/Grey: A classic and popular choice, replicating the original look of many factory wheels.
- Diamond Cut: This involves machining the face of the wheel to create a bright, metallic finish, which is then protected by a clear lacquer. This is a popular high-end finish.
- Gloss Black/Satin Black: A modern and sporty look that can dramatically change a vehicle's appearance.
- Coloured Finishes: Virtually any colour can be achieved, from subtle metallic tones to vibrant custom shades.
- Hyper Silver/Chrome Effect: These offer a highly reflective, mirror-like finish.
Benefits of Wheel Refurbishment
Opting for refurbishment offers several compelling advantages:
- Cost Savings: Refurbishment is significantly cheaper than buying new alloy wheels. A full set of new wheels can cost hundreds, if not thousands, of pounds, whereas refurbishment typically costs a fraction of that.
- Environmental Friendliness: By repairing and reusing existing wheels, you reduce waste and the need for manufacturing new ones, which is a more sustainable choice.
- Enhanced Aesthetics: Restored wheels can make your car look significantly newer and better maintained, improving its overall visual appeal.
- Increased Resale Value: A car with pristine wheels is more attractive to potential buyers and can command a higher resale price. Damaged wheels can be a significant deterrent.
- Preserves Originality: If you have a classic or cherished vehicle, refurbishing the original wheels maintains its authenticity.
- Improved Performance (Minor): While not a primary benefit, ensuring wheels are straight and properly balanced contributes to a smoother ride and can slightly improve handling and tyre wear.
Choosing a Refurbishment Service
When selecting a company for your wheel refurbishment, consider the following:
- Reputation and Reviews: Look for established businesses with positive customer feedback. Check online reviews and testimonials.
- Experience: How long have they been operating? Do they specialise in wheel refurbishment?
- Services Offered: Do they handle the specific type of damage your wheels have? Do they offer the finish you desire?
- Turnaround Time: How long will the process take? Some services offer while-you-wait options or loan wheels.
- Warranty: Does the company offer a warranty on their work? This provides peace of mind.
- Price: While price is a factor, it shouldn't be the only consideration. The cheapest option may not always provide the best quality or durability.

Table: Refurbishment vs. Replacement Costs (Illustrative)
The following table provides an *illustrative* comparison of costs. Actual prices will vary significantly based on the wheel size, complexity of the finish, and the specific service provider.
| Service | Estimated Cost Per Wheel (UK Pounds) | Notes |
|---|---|---|
| Standard Refurbishment (Paint/Powder Coat) | £60 - £120 | Covers scuffs, corrosion, new paint finish. |
| Diamond Cut Refurbishment | £90 - £180 | Includes machining and clear coat. More labour-intensive. |
| Wheel Straightening (Minor Bend) | £30 - £60 | Added to refurbishment cost if required. |
| New Replacement Wheel (OEM Equivalent) | £150 - £400+ | Can be significantly higher for performance or luxury vehicles. |
| New Aftermarket Wheel | £100 - £300+ | Varies widely based on brand, design, and quality. |
Frequently Asked Questions (FAQs)
Q1: Can all damaged wheels be refurbished?
Most wheels with cosmetic damage like scuffs, scratches, and corrosion can be successfully refurbished. Wheels with significant structural damage, such as large cracks or severe distortion, may not be repairable and might need replacement for safety reasons.
Q2: How long does the refurbishment process take?
The time required can vary. A basic refurbishment might take a few hours if done on-site, while a more comprehensive process involving stripping, straightening, and re-coating can take several days. Many reputable services aim for a 24-48 hour turnaround for a set of four wheels.
Q3: Will refurbishment affect the wheel's balance?
A professional refurbishment process includes wheel balancing after the repair and coating. This ensures the wheel spins smoothly and prevents vibrations.
Q4: Is powder coating or liquid paint better?
Powder coating is generally considered more durable and resistant to chipping and scratching than liquid paint. However, liquid paint can offer a wider range of finishes and is often used for intricate designs like diamond cutting.
Q5: How do I maintain my refurbished wheels?
Clean your wheels regularly with mild, pH-neutral car shampoo and water. Avoid abrasive cleaners, harsh chemicals, or high-pressure washing directly on the wheel surface, especially close up. Dry them with a soft microfiber cloth.
